What's the "applicator"?

Here's a good shot of the applicator: http://www.bikebandit.com/product/16090

It's the little black plastic piece that helps guide the tape as you apply it to the rim as well as remove the backing.  It's a little fussy to get the hang of, but once you've got it - you're golden.

Which Rhino bar ends did you order? 
2008 Monster 695, DP ECU, Low mount C/F Termignonis, Open Airbox, Oil Cooler...

wisdesign

Not sure exactly which ones they are as I bought them from my dealer along with the CRG mirrors.  They've definitely got an adapter and seem to be fairly universal for fitting typical bar ID and the CRG Hindsight mirrors.  Sorry I can't be of more help. 

hcomp

#36
You have to order the Rhinomoto  small I.D. adapters for the 696 bars ie. for Classic Ducati Mirror Mounts.  I really like them as well.
